The Simple Moving Average indicator is calculated by adding the closing price of Smallcap for a given number of time periods and then dividing this total by the number of time periods. It is used to smooth out Smallcap Sp 600 short-term fluctuations and highlight longer-term trends or cycles.

Smallcap's time-series forecasting models are one of many Smallcap's mutual fund analysis techniques aimed at predicting future share value based on previously observed values. Time-series forecasting models ae widely used for non-stationary data. Non-stationary data are called the data whose statistical properties e.g. the mean and standard deviation are not constant over time but instead, these metrics vary over time. These non-stationary Smallcap's historical data is usually called time-series. Some empirical experimentation suggests that the statistical forecasting models outperform the models based exclusively on fundamental analysis to predict the direction of the market movement and maximize returns from investment trading.

Under normal circumstances, the fund invests at least 80 percent of its net assets, plus any borrowings for investment purposes, in equity securities of companies that compose the Standard Poors SmallCap 600 Index. The index is designed to represent U.S. equities with riskreturn characteristics of the small cap universe. The fund uses derivative strategies and invests in exchange-traded funds .
